Time turns a blind eye
as our atoms collide
Your side against mine
Clocking another slow ride
Yesterday’s dreams
they were bluer than sea
There was even a breeze
warmly breathing the trees
And believe me
the deep history you bring along
sometimes troubles the beat
of my simple song
Forget that though now
Lose the thought from your main brain
and join me once again
on the early train
the fast track
Our gravy train
From love and back
